Hiding helmet & weapons – completely and in cutscenes

If you’re tired of your hunter’s face being constantly covered by a helmet, you can easily change that in two ways:

  • Go to Settings → Game Settings → Page 2 → Headgear Visibility

Here you can choose whether your helmet should always be displayed, not at all, or only not in cutscenes.

Can I also hide my weapon? Similarly, you can hide your weapons if they bother you – but only in cutscenes. If they bother you in the game itself, unfortunately, you have to live with it for now. You can find the option one floor up on the same page.

If you don’t want to go to the settings every time you wear a cool helmet, there is another way because:

  • Go into your tent at the camp and select Equipment Appearance. There you can choose which armor pieces you would like to show at the moment using the sliders. This option also works for your Palico via the button Palico Equipment Appearance.

Changing armor appearance and color

Up to high-rank quests, you must live with the equipment you are currently wearing. If you have no problems with the monsters facing you, you can wear what you like for as long as you want.

Or you can get so-called cosmetic armor from the shop or from the deluxe edition, which you can put on. Cosmetic armors are something like skins that you can purely cosmetically put over your worn armor.

Once you reach high-rank quests, you can also use “normal” armor as so-called cosmetic armor (Layered Armor). This way, you can simply put any high-rank equipment piece you forge over your currently worn equipment. That way, you do not have to miss out on stats or appearance.

To customize the appearance of your equipment or your Palico’s, go into your tent and select Equipment Appearance at the last tab. From this point onward, you can also dye your armor. Unfortunately, this is not possible in lower-rank quests.

Customizing the appearance of the hunter and the Palico

If you are not satisfied with your hunter or your cat-like companion, there is also a way to adjust some aspects in the game later on. The options are somewhat limited, but they still offer some possibilities to optimize your character.

To access these options, simply go into your tent at the camp and select the option Change Appearance at the last tab.

You do not need a Character or Palico Edit Voucher for these changes. However, if you want to adjust your appearance on a larger scale, that will be needed and you will have to start an adjustment in the character selection.
